-
81.
公开(公告)号:US10785186B2
公开(公告)日:2020-09-22
申请号:US16226444
申请日:2018-12-19
Applicant: Cisco Technology, Inc.
Inventor: Mehak Mahajan , Samir D. Thoria , Shyam Kapadia
Abstract: A method is provided in one example embodiment and includes receiving at a controller an Address Resolution Protocol (“ARP”) packet from a source VXLAN Tunnel End Point (“VTEP”) serving a source host and identifying a destination, the source VTEP having assigned thereto a Virtual Network Identifier (“VNI”) identifying a VXLAN network to which the source VTEP and a plurality of other VTEPs belong, the ARP packet being received by the controller via a control plane; determining whether the received ARP packet is a request message; and, if the received ARP packet is a request message, determining whether address information for the identified destination is stored in a cache of the controller.
-
公开(公告)号:US10708185B2
公开(公告)日:2020-07-07
申请号:US15827183
申请日:2017-11-30
Applicant: Cisco Technology, Inc.
Inventor: Sathish Srinivasan , Shyam Kapadia , Lukas Krattiger , Rajesh Sharma
IPC: H04L12/741 , H04L12/713 , H04L12/46 , H04L29/06
Abstract: A first network device advertises routes of locally connected routes/subnetworks based on the connectivity of the host with respect to peer network devices. The first network device establishes a virtual port channel associated with a virtual network address. The virtual port channel includes the first network device associated with a first network address and a second network device associated with a second network address. The first network device detects that a host is connected to the first network device and determines a next hop address to associate with the host. The next hop address is determined based on whether the host is also connected to the second network device of the virtual port channel. The first network device generates a route advertisement associating the next hop address with the host.
-
公开(公告)号:US10523504B1
公开(公告)日:2019-12-31
申请号:US15842411
申请日:2017-12-14
Applicant: Cisco Technology, Inc.
Inventor: Vipin Jain , Suran Saminda de Silva , Shyam Kapadia , Nilesh Shah
IPC: H04L12/24 , H04L12/933
Abstract: A method is provided in one example embodiment and includes creating a segment organization, which includes a configuration profile. The method also includes attaching the configuration profile to a server in the segment organization. The method further includes sending the attached configuration profile to a database in a physical network.
-
公开(公告)号:US10516544B2
公开(公告)日:2019-12-24
申请号:US15649479
申请日:2017-07-13
Applicant: CISCO TECHNOLOGY, INC.
Inventor: Victor Manuel Moreno , Shyam Kapadia , Sanjay Kumar Hooda
IPC: G06F17/30 , H04L29/12 , H04L12/18 , H04L29/06 , H04L12/46 , H04L12/24 , H04L12/733 , H04L12/761
Abstract: A Location/Identifier Separation Protocol (LISP) mapping server, including: a network interface for communicating with a LISP-enabled network; a mapping database; an extranet policy table; and a shared subnetwork mapping engine (SSME), including at least a hardware platform, configured to: receive a map request from a first endpoint serviced by a first xTR, the first endpoint on a first subnetwork, the map request for a second endpoint; determine that the second endpoint is not a member of the first subnetwork; query the extranet policy table to identify a second subnetwork that the first subnetwork subscribes to, and to determine that the second endpoint is a member of the second subnetwork; and provide to the first subnetwork a routing locator (RLOC) of an xTR servicing the second endpoint.
-
公开(公告)号:US10298698B2
公开(公告)日:2019-05-21
申请号:US15205031
申请日:2016-07-08
Applicant: Cisco Technology, Inc.
Inventor: Shyam Kapadia , Lukas Krattiger , Wing Hon Yeung , Uffaz Nathaniel , Richard Lam
Abstract: Presented herein are techniques for actively monitoring, at a network controller, a network location of an endpoint connected to the network based on control plane updates. The network controller is configured to archive the network location of the endpoint, along with local information for the endpoint, in an endpoint tracking database of the network controller.
-
公开(公告)号:US20180309685A1
公开(公告)日:2018-10-25
申请号:US15496146
申请日:2017-04-25
Applicant: Cisco Technology, Inc.
Inventor: Sathish Srinivasan , Shyam Kapadia , Deepak Kumar , Indrajanti Pallikala , Rohit Mendiratta , Lukas Krattiger
IPC: H04L12/855 , H04L12/725 , H04L12/741 , H04L29/12 , H04L12/46 , H04L12/715
CPC classification number: H04L45/04 , H04L45/302 , H04L45/745 , H04L61/103 , H04L61/2007 , H04L61/6022
Abstract: A first network node of a computer network discovers a host route by leveraging a temporary host route on the control plane of the computer network. The first network node receives, from a source host, a request for a host route associated with a destination host. The first network node determines that it has not previously stored the host route associated with the destination host, and generates a temporary host route associated with the destination host. The first network node propagates the temporary host route across the control plane of the computer network, causing each respective network node to discover if the destination host is connected to the respective network node.
-
公开(公告)号:US20180183753A1
公开(公告)日:2018-06-28
申请号:US15465496
申请日:2017-03-21
Applicant: Cisco Technology, Inc.
Inventor: Srividya Vemulakonda , Huilong Huang , Shyam Kapadia , Rajesh B. Nataraja , Liqin Dong , Stephanie Wong
CPC classification number: H04L61/2015 , H04L41/0809 , H04L41/0853 , H04L41/0876 , H04L41/0886 , H04L61/103 , H04L61/6022
Abstract: In one implementation, a method performed by a first node with interfaces configured as IP unnumbered interfaces sharing a single IP address and to communicate with a DHCP-associated second node includes: obtaining a first message that indicates a configuration status of a third node at a respective interface; obtaining a second message for the third node from the DHCP-associated second node that includes a temporary IP address for the third node and an indicator of a file server; obtaining a third message associated with the third node that includes the temporary IP address, the third message requests address information for the file server; and configuring the third node by establishing a connection between the third node and the file server to transfer at least one configuration file, where configuring the third node includes providing the temporary IP address to the DHCP-associated second node via BGP.
-
公开(公告)号:US20180054326A1
公开(公告)日:2018-02-22
申请号:US15785134
申请日:2017-10-16
Applicant: Cisco Technology, Inc.
Inventor: Shyam Kapadia , Rick Chang , Yibin Yang , Rajesh Babu Nataraja
IPC: H04L12/46 , H04L12/24 , H04L12/931 , H04L12/753
CPC classification number: H04L12/4641 , H04L12/4625 , H04L12/4633 , H04L41/0803 , H04L41/0816 , H04L41/12 , H04L41/26 , H04L45/48 , H04L49/354
Abstract: In accordance with one example embodiment, there is provided a system configured for virtual local area network (VLAN) blocking on a virtual port channel (vPC) member link to handle discrepant virtual network instance (VNI) to VLAN mappings. In other embodiments, the system can be configured for providing Virtual Switch Interface Discovery Protocol (VDP) and virtual switch enhancements to accommodate discrepant VNI to VLAN mappings. In another example embodiment, an apparatus is provided that includes a processor, and a memory coupled to the processor, where the apparatus is configured such that if a server is connected through a virtual port channel, a VDP is used to notify the server of different VNI to VLAN mappings. In another embodiment, the apparatus can extend a VDP Filter Info Field to carry a set of VLANs mapped to a VNI, keyed by leaf MAC addresses that serve as bridge identifiers.
-
公开(公告)号:US20180034747A1
公开(公告)日:2018-02-01
申请号:US15224158
申请日:2016-07-29
Applicant: CISCO TECHNOLOGY, INC.
Inventor: Rajesh Babu Nataraja , Shyam Kapadia , Lei Fu , Nilesh Shah
IPC: H04L12/931 , H04L12/24 , H04L12/46
CPC classification number: H04L49/70 , H04L12/4641 , H04L41/0803
Abstract: A method is described and in one embodiment includes receiving at a top-of-rack (“TOR”) switch a notification concerning a virtual machine (“VM”), wherein the received notification identifies a host associated with the VM; determining whether the identified host is directly connected to the TOR switch; and if the identified host is not directly connected to the TOR switch, identifying an intermediate switch to which the identified host is directly connected; and determining whether the identified intermediate switch to which the identified host is directly attached is attached to the TOR switch.
-
90.
公开(公告)号:US20170317919A1
公开(公告)日:2017-11-02
申请号:US15143202
申请日:2016-04-29
Applicant: CISCO TECHNOLOGY, INC.
Inventor: Rex Emmanuel Fernando , Victor Manuel Moreno , Shyam Kapadia , Liqin Dong , Murali Venkateshaiah
IPC: H04L12/761 , H04L12/46 , H04L29/12
CPC classification number: H04L61/103 , H04L12/4633 , H04L41/0806 , H04L41/12 , H04L61/6022
Abstract: A system and a method are disclosed for enabling interoperability between data plane learning endpoints and control plane learning endpoints in an overlay network environment. An exemplary method for managing network traffic in the overlay network environment includes receiving network packets in an overlay network from data plane learning endpoints and control plane learning endpoints, wherein the overlay network extends Layer 2 network traffic over a Layer 3 network; operating in a data plane learning mode when a network packet is received from a data plane learning endpoint; and operating in a control plane learning mode when the network packet is received from a control plane learning endpoint. Where the overlay network includes more than one overlay segment, the method further includes operating as an anchor node for routing inter-overlay segment traffic to and from hosts that operate behind the data plane learning endpoints.
-
-
-
-
-
-
-
-
-